Output b943bf44bb145482cce55fc2a1ffd32acc95bec81aa31be00a682054e5b2c14b:0

value
17412902
script pubkey
OP_0 OP_PUSHBYTES_20 33143519065cd73d4ea437873efe83ed7ab7cfa4
address
bc1qxv2r2xgxtntn6n4yx7rnal5ra4at0nay3re3ex
transaction
b943bf44bb145482cce55fc2a1ffd32acc95bec81aa31be00a682054e5b2c14b
confirmations
8319
spent
true